Video: Hvordan fungerer aggregat i Mongodb?
2024 Forfatter: Lynn Donovan | [email protected]. Sist endret: 2023-12-15 23:51
Aggregasjon i MongoDB . Aggregasjon i MongoDB er ingenting annet enn en operasjon som brukes til å behandle dataene som returnerer de beregnede resultatene. Aggregasjon grupperer i utgangspunktet dataene fra flere dokumenter og opererer på mange måter på de grupperte dataene for å returnere ett kombinert resultat.
Dessuten, hva gjør $project i MongoDB?
$ prosjekt tar et dokument som kan spesifisere inkludering av felt, undertrykkelse av _id-feltet, tillegg av nye felt og tilbakestilling av verdiene til eksisterende felt. Legger til et nytt felt eller tilbakestiller verdien til et eksisterende felt. Endret i versjon 3.6: MongoDB 3.6 legger til variabelen REMOVE.
For det andre, hva er aggregater forklare med eksempel i Nosql? An samlet er en samling av data som vi samhandler med som en enhet. Disse enhetene av data eller aggregater danner grensene for ACID-operasjoner med database-, nøkkelverdi-, dokument- og kolonnefamiliedatabaser kan alle sees på som former for samlet -orientert database.
Også å vite er, hva er aggregeringsrørledning i MongoDB?
MongoDB Aggregation pipeline er et rammeverk for data aggregering . Den er basert på konseptet databehandling rørledninger . Dokumenter går inn i et flertrinn rørledning som forvandler dokumentene til en aggregert resultater. Den ble introdusert i MongoDB 2.2 å gjøre aggregering operasjoner uten å måtte bruke map-reduce.
Hva er $Group i MongoDB?
Definisjon. $ gruppe . Grupper legge inn dokumenter med det spesifiserte _id-uttrykket og for hver distinkte gruppering, gir ut et dokument. _id-feltet for hvert utdatadokument inneholder den unike gruppe etter verdi. Utdatadokumentene kan også inneholde beregnede felt som inneholder verdiene til et eller annet akkumulatoruttrykk.
Anbefalt:
Hvordan fungerer Spring AOP proxy?
AOP-proxy: et objekt opprettet av AOP-rammeverket for å implementere aspektkontraktene (gi råd om metodeutførelser og så videre). I Spring Framework vil en AOP proxy være en JDK dynamisk proxy eller en CGLIB proxy. Veving: koble aspekter med andre applikasjonstyper eller objekter for å lage et anbefalt objekt
Hva betyr aggregat i forskning?
Definisjon og typer av aggregater Aggregater produseres ved å kombinere informasjon fra flere kilder. Når du samler data, bruker du en eller flere oppsummeringsstatistikker, for eksempel gjennomsnitt, median eller modus, for å gi en enkel og rask beskrivelse av et eller annet fenomen av interesse
Hvordan fungerer MongoDB-klynger?
En mongodb-klynge er ordet som vanligvis brukes for sharded cluster i mongodb. Hovedformålene med en sharded mongodb er: Skala leser og skriver langs flere noder. Hver node håndterer ikke hele dataene, så du kan skille data langs alle nodene i sharden
Kan du bruke gruppe etter uten aggregat?
Du kan bruke GROUP BY-leddet uten å bruke en aggregert funksjon. Følgende spørring henter data fra betalingstabellen og grupperer resultatet etter kunde-ID. I dette tilfellet fungerer GROUP BY som DISTINCT-leddet som fjerner dupliserte rader fra resultatsettet
Hvordan fungerer indekser i MongoDB?
Indekser støtter effektiv utførelse av spørringer i MongoDB. Uten indekser må MongoDB utføre en samlingsskanning, dvs. skanne hvert dokument i en samling, for å velge de dokumentene som samsvarer med spørringssetningen. Indeksen lagrer verdien til et spesifikt felt eller sett med felt, sortert etter verdien til feltet